Description

Keep your students writing -- no matter what your year looks like! Digital and print journal prompts. 29 February-focused writing prompts based on quirky holidays, important days in history, and funny/inspirational quotes.

Print or digital -- You'll get both!

Did you know that February holidays include National Cherry Pie Day? That's just of the 29 prompts you'll find in this resource. Topics include trivia, historical events, silly/serious holidays, and thoughtful quotes. Topics that students love to explore and write about!
